This is a great game. Simple, yet addictive. And it seems to be totally unique, which is a huge plus in my book. It also became a lot easier once I realized that you don't have to select numbers in a straight line. Wish that had been in the instructions. I would give it 5 stars, but there are a few small issues I have with it. First, it can be hard to be sure which numbers you have selected since your finger in on the playing board. It would be cool if the selected numbers appeared up top like so: "9 + 5 + 1" or something like that. It would also be nice if there was an audible clue like a click or something. I'd also like to see an untimed option where you can just play as long as you like without worrying about the score or time. Finally, I'd like an option to turn off the shake to get a new number. There were a few times when it seemed that tapping the screen was enough to change the number leaving me very confused. Even with those issues, this game is still worth the asking price and will be a welcome addition for anyone who like number games.
